Kevin Costner’s ‘Yellowstone’ Set to Return Mid-Year For Season Five on Paramount Network

Paramount Network’s hit show Yellowstone is set to return for its fifth season this summer, Deadline reports. The exact premiere date has yet to be announced. 

The Taylor Sheridan (Wind River, 1883) drama, which stars Wes Bentley (American Horror Story) and features the return of Josh Lucas (Sweet Home Alabama) as young John Dutton, has been a major success for the network. In fact, the season five trailer set streaming records with 14.4 million views and 1.7 million engagements within the first 24 hours of its release, per Deadline. The season premiere was also up 52% in adults 18-34 compared to the season four debut, with over 12 million viewers tuning in across multiple Viacom-owned platforms.

In addition to the core cast, Season five also welcomed new cast members Jacki Weaver (Animal Kingdom), Kylie Rogers (Home Before Dark), Kyle Red Silverstein (Blended), Kai Caster (American Horror Story), singer Lainey Wilson, Lilli Kay (Your Honor), and Dawn Olivieri (House of Lies). The show was co-created by Sheridan and John Linson (The Outsider), with Linson, Art Linson (Where the Buffalo Roam), Sheridan, Kevin Costner (Waterworld), David C. Glasser (Hidden Obsession), Bob Yari (Haven), and Stephen Kay (Boogeyman) serving as executive producers.
